Why You Don’t Want “Normal” Blood Lead Levels

“By the 1950s, lead—a harmful neurotoxin that was as soon as buried deep within the floor, distant from people—had polluted the complete planet.” Now we have leaded gasoline to thank for this. It’s onerous to think about “a greater technique for maximizing inhabitants publicity to a poison than to have it emitted by a ubiquitous cellular supply and to line the surfaces of dwellings” and our neighborhoods with it.

“Total, about 5 million metric tons of lead was deposited within the surroundings because of the combustion of leaded gasoline” by our cars earlier than it was regulated. A single busy road may obtain greater than a metric ton a 12 months, and the lead simply constructed up, decade after decade. Lastly, because of rules beginning within the 1970s, we stopped spewing a lot into the air. As you’ll be able to see at 0:57 in my video “Regular” Blood Lead Levels Can Be Poisonous, as lead use dropped, so did the degrees of lead in our blood, leading to a 98 p.c discount within the proportion of younger youngsters with elevated blood lead ranges. In fact, the time period “elevated” is relative.

“Previous to 1970, lead poisoning was outlined by a blood lead focus of 60 mg/dL or larger” however “since then, the blood lead focus for outlining lead toxicity step by step has been diminished” to 40 mg/dL, then 30 mg/dL, then 25 mg/dL, after which additional all the way down to 10mg/dL, as lead ranges “beforehand regarded as protected or inconsequential for kids have constantly been proven to be danger elements” for cognitive and behavioral issues.

At the moment, an elevated blood lead stage is taken into account to be greater than 5 mg/dL. So, underneath 5 mg/dL, your lead stage is taken into account to be non-elevated or regular. However what does having a “regular” lead stage imply?

“Just about all residents of industrialized international locations have bone lead shops which might be a number of orders of magnitude larger than these of our preindustrial ancestors.” For those who go to a museum and check the lead ranges of historic skeletons buried a millennium in the past, they’re a thousand occasions decrease in comparison with individuals immediately, “which signifies the possible existence inside most People of dysfunctions attributable to poisoning from persistent, extreme overexposures to industrial Pb lead.”

You can see a graphical illustration of “physique burdens of lead” in a preindustrial ancestor, a typical American citizen, and an individual with overtly symptomatic lead poisoning, the place he is likely to be doubled over in ache, at 2:30 in my video. What the medical and analysis communities had failed to grasp is that they’d solely involved themselves with individuals with precise lead poisoning and people at “typical” lead ranges, however “the brand new worth for pure lead ranges in [preindustrial] people reveals that typical ranges of lead in people are fairly positively not correctly described by the time period ‘very low ranges’ in any respect, however as a substitute represent grossly extreme, 1000-fold over-exposure ranges.”

 The underside line? “No stage of lead publicity seems to be ‘protected’ and even the present ‘low’ ranges of publicity in youngsters are related to neurodevelopmental deficits,” together with diminished IQ. It may have been rather a lot worse if we hadn’t began limiting leaded fuel. Due to falling blood lead ranges beginning within the 1970s, preschoolers born within the 1990s have been two to 5 IQ factors larger than children like me born earlier than 1976. So, once we see our youngsters and grandkids being such wizzes at expertise that it’s onerous to maintain up with them, a small a part of that could be them not struggling as a lot lead-induced mind injury as we did. And, what meaning for the nation is doubtlessly tons of of billions of {dollars} of improved productiveness as a result of our kids are much less brain-damaged.

If that looks as if rather a lot for just some IQ factors, as you’ll be able to see at 4:26 in my video, what it’s a must to notice is that even a small shift in common IQ may lead to a 50 p.c improve within the variety of the “mentally retarded,” thousands and thousands extra in want of particular schooling and providers.

So, “elimination of lead from gasoline in america has been described as one of many nice public well being achievements of the 20th century, but it surely virtually didn’t occur.” Certainly, “large stress by the lead trade itself was dropped at bear to quiet, even intimidate, researchers and clinicians who reported on or recognized lead as a hazard.” First rate “scientists and well being officers confronted monumental opposition however by no means overpassed the mandate to guard public well being.”

Two of the “younger, idealistic workers” on the newly fashioned Environmental Safety Company, who performed key roles within the combat, recount how “naïve [they were] to the methods of Washington”:

“Our youth was additionally used towards us. Our inexperience was cited as a cause for rejecting the lead regulatory proposals….Lastly, looking back, our youth and inexperience additionally helped us to achieve taking over a billion greenback trade. We have been too younger to know, that regulating lead in gasoline was inconceivable.”
